Abstract

The utility model relates to the technical field of electronic auxiliary equipment, in particular to a control box of a heater, which comprises a main body, wherein one end of the main body is provided with a slidable fixing device, one end of the main body is provided with a conical block above the fixing device, and one end of the conical block penetrates through the fixing device and extends to the outside of the fixing device. Background
The electric heater is an electric appliance which utilizes electric energy to achieve a heating effect, and is generally controlled by a control box, the control box is used as an important component of various control devices, the performance of the control box has a key influence on the performance of the devices, for example, a robot control box and a machine tool control box are all provided with various key components, the control box has the function of accommodating the components, plays a role in temperature regulation, and ensures that the components in the cabinet can operate within a proper temperature range. When the existing control box is assembled, holes need to be formed in the control box and the control box is fixed through screws, so that the labor intensity of workers is increased, and the control box needs a long time to be assembled.

Referring to fig. 1 to 4, a control box of a heater includes a main body 1, a slidable fixing device 2 mounted at one end of the main body 1, a tapered block 3 mounted at one end of the main body 1 and above the fixing device 2, and one end of the tapered block 3 penetrating through the fixing device 2 and extending to the outside of the fixing device 2.
The main body 1 is fixed at the using position through the fixing device 2, and is fixed at the using position through the clamping block 24 on the disc 22, and simultaneously, the conical block 3 is driven to move downwards through the gravity of the main body 1, so that the clamping block 24 is tightly fixed at the using position.
As shown in fig. 2, based on the above technical solution, further describing the fixing device 2, the fixing device 2 includes a fixing box 21, and a disc 22 is installed at one end of the fixing box 21. One end of the disc 22 is provided with a chute 23, and a clamping block 24 is slidably mounted on the inner wall of the chute 23.
The lugs in the use position are clamped by the clamping blocks 24 on the disc 22, so that the whole main body 1 is fixed in the use position.
As shown in fig. 3, based on the above technical solution, further describing the fixing box 21, concave blocks 25 are installed on two sides of the inner cavity of the fixing box 21, and an elastic mechanism 26 is installed on one side opposite to the two concave blocks 25. A gear rack 27 is mounted on the opposite side of the two elastic means 26. An expansion rod 28 is arranged in the inner cavity of the fixed box 21 and positioned at one side of the concave block 25. An all-gear 29 is mounted at one end of the telescopic rod 28, and the outer surface of the all-gear 29 is engaged with one side of the gear rack 27. The outer surface of the conical block 3 is attached to the outer surface of the gear rack 27, and the outer surface of the telescopic rod 28 is fixedly provided with a slidable connecting rod 30. One end of the connecting rod 30 penetrates the fixed case 21 and extends to the outside of the fixed case 21. The other end of the connecting rod 21 is connected to one end of the clamping block 24.
By moving the tapered block 3 downward, the two gear bars 27 are moved to both sides, and the telescopic rod 28 is moved in the opposite direction to the gear bars 27, and the clamping blocks 24 are moved toward the middle.
The working principle is as follows: when the device is used, the two gear strips 27 in the fixed box 21 move towards two sides through the downward movement of the conical block 3 on the main body 1, so that the telescopic rod 28 moves towards the opposite direction of the gear strips 27 and drives the connecting rod 30 to move, then the clamping block 24 is moved towards the middle through the connecting rod 30, and then the clamping block 24 clamps a convex block on a use position, so that the main body 1 is integrally fixed on the use position.
